II. Unlocking the Mystery of the Universal Donor Blood Type: Everything You Need to Know

The O- blood type is considered a universal donor. This means that it can be transfused into people with other blood types without causing an adverse reaction. Approximately 7% of the world’s population has O- blood type, making it a rare blood type, yet valuable in transfusion purposes. But what is it that makes O- blood type unique?

The explanation lies in the presence of red blood cells that do not have specific antigens found in A, B, or AB blood types. Because O- blood type does not have these antigens, it can be transfused into anyone regardless of their blood type.

IV. Why O- Blood Type is the Go-To for Emergencies and Blood Transfusions

The ABO blood typing system classifies blood types into categories A, B, AB, or O according to whether the red blood cells contain A, B, both A and B, or neither A nor B antigens. Blood type compatibility in transfusions is determined by the presence or absence of specific antigens in the red blood cells. Matching the blood type between the donor and recipient is crucial in preventing severe transfusion reactions.

Because O- blood type has no specific antigens in the red blood cells, it can be used in transfusions for people with different blood types. This gives it an edge over other blood types, making it the go-to for emergency situations that require blood transfusions.

V. The Universal Donor: Understanding the Genetics Behind Blood Typing

The ABO blood typing system is determined by the presence of specific genes that control the production of antigens present in red blood cells. The gene responsible for the production of the A antigen is the A allele, B is for the B antigen, and the O allele does not produce either antigen. The combination of these alleles results in different blood types such as A, B, AB, or O. Understanding the genetics behind blood typing is crucial in successful transfusions, as it helps determine blood type compatibility.

In addition to the ABO blood typing system, the Rhesus (Rh) factor is also an important factor. An Rh+ person has the Rh factor on their red blood cells, while an Rh- person does not. This further classifies blood types, such as O- blood type, as negative for both ABO and Rh factors.

VII. The Power of O- Blood Type: One Donation Can Help Multiple Patients in Need

When you donate blood, different components of the blood such as red blood cells, plasma, and platelets are separated and used to help multiple patients with different needs. For example, one single blood donation can help as many as three patients in need, depending on their requirements.

Donating O- blood type can make an even greater difference because it can be transferred to people with other blood types. This means one O- blood type donation can save multiple lives, making it an even more valuable resource in our communities.
